How they compare
Fiji currently reports 7.4% against 6.8% in Thailand, a difference of 0.6%.
That makes Fiji's figure about 1.1 times Thailand's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Thailand has been ahead every year.
Fiji ranks 111th and Thailand ranks 113th of 175 countries.
Thailand has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
